How to Choose the Right Serviced Office Space For You

 

Are you looking to have something seamless and easy to integrate? If the answer is yes, you need to consider getting a serviced office space. This idea has become popular over time because most people prefer having their office already serviced because it cuts down on costs significantly. Before getting a serviced office space, there are a number of things that you need to consider. Outlined below are some of the major tips that can help you get the right office space for you.

 

Are They Conveniently Located?

You will need to start by figuring out if the offices from this homepage you are considering are conveniently located. As a business person, you will have to think about your clients and your staff. Consider the hassle that they have to go through just to get to your office. Remember that if your office is located in an area that your clients cannot access, they will eventually get tired and they will look for another service provider. Therefore, you will need to consider the location of the office and whether it served your clients, your staff and yourself well.

 

Look For Recommendations

It is also important for you to consider asking people that you know to recommend some really nice serviced offices that you can check out. Sometimes doing all the research on your own can look like a huge task. Therefore, it is recommended that if you can get some help from people who have tried out serviced offices, it is better if you ask them to recommend. Consider the Cost of Renting

Rates differ and this is why you need to compare them. You can check out different service providers that are renting out serviced offices. In most cases, you will find the rates on their websites. However, even if you do not, you can always make calls and inquire directly from the service providers. Look for something affordable but above all things, make sure that you are getting value for your money.

 

Available Space

The fourth factor that you need to consider is the amount of space that you need. If you have meeting a lot with clients or business partners, you should drift more towards offices with enough space or even boardrooms. Make sure that the space you are getting is enough to meet your needs. Consider Your Style

To sum things up, you can look at the style and office design. If you are a creative for example, consider looking for a serviced office that gives clients that creative feel.
